I would like to leave this + modification to you or other developers who can test it. + It was quite big modification and I do not believe that I haven't + make any mistakes but I hope that in few weeks I'll fix any reported + bugs and it will resolve any PP problems. + TODO: + * error messages + create one common list of errors and warnings and keep it + in common library. PP and compiler can still generate different + errors with the same number. It can be confusing for the users + and hard to document and add i18n translations. + If possible we should also try to keep Clipper error numbers. + In new PP code I added Clipper error numbers but I cannot use + them until compiler code is not updated. + We should aslo remove the ctype passed to error functions and + hack with first character in warning messages and use only + error number. The codes from 1000 to 1999 should be warnings + where range 1000:1099 is activated by -w, 1100:1199 by -w1, + 1200:1299 by -w2, etc. 2000:2999 are errors and 3000:3999 + fatal errors. All compiler functions which generate an error + should expect that error function will not stop the compiler + but return and cleanly finished their job. It's necessary for + MT support in compiler and making compiler part of some other + programs which may still work and compile different source code. + * FLEX/SIMPLEX + remove them at all and add some final pass to PP to create + more precise tokens for grammar parser or at least add better + integration to remove some redundant code and existing limits. + * hb_inLine() support - it's broken in new PP but as I can see + it was never working correctly.
